Happy Easter Nails!

Ok, I know that the Easter is not just about bunnies and birdies and chocolate,  (Don't get me wrong, my Easter is quite much about those three, especially chocolate...) but I couldn't resist the urge to do a super happy easter manicure.  Have a happy weekend, whether you celebrate Easter or not!
On the left hand I used:
two coats of SpaRitual Moss on all the nails
two coats of Lumene Summer Rain on ring & pointer
two coats of Kleancolor Green Holo on the middle finger.
On the right hand I used:
Orly Spark all over
Attitude Lemon Sherbet on the ring & pointer
Kleancolor Holo Yellow on the middle finger
To decorate, I:
Painted the grass and the chick with Moss & Spark
Added eyes with Mavala Black and White, beak with China Glaze Papaya Punch and footprints with Mavala Black.
Finally, I added some fimo slices to the right hand.
A Coat of Seche Vite, and I was happy. Sometimes it's indeed the small things that matter...

Astral Butterfly

This is a happy neon mani I made, just for fun! Isn't that how nail art should always be?

The base is two coats of Color Club Ultra-Astral, my new favourite pink. I eBayed it recently and from the moment I opened the package I've been regretting I didn't get the whole Starry Temptress collection.
Something was still missing after those two coats, and I remembered seeing all the Starry Temptress collection polishes swatched with the matching top coat. That one I didn't have, but I added a coat of Essence Colour&Go Space Queen, which gives quite a similar effect.
Lastly, I added a butterfly fimo from a chinese store and some dots with Wild and Crazy Montana and Sinful Colors Summer Peach. I almost got the right colours in this pic - propably because of the white polish I'm holding. I'll keep that in mind... And here are the other polishes.
